Kansas sports betting background
Kansas released its very first legal mobile sportsbooks in 2022. Six books now take bets: BetMGM, Caesars, DraftKings, ESPN BET, Fanatics and FanDuel.
The capability to place legal bets in Kansas brings in bettors on the Missouri side of the Kansas City metro area to Kansas to wager, with some doing so most or nearly every day of the week.
That might change if Kansas lawmakers upend the present regulatory structure. Sources tell Covers some lawmakers wish to increase the state's sports betting tax earnings, sports betting amongst the most affordable per capita of any of the 30 states with statewide legal mobile sportsbooks.
